Friday Night, December 21. a review

Post by Cherri »

Hey there...I don't know if I am following the format or posting in the right place, but I shall venture forth in saying that I saw Mitchell Tobin tonight, a wonderful little guy who did a fabulous job!! I was sooo impressed with his singing and his dancing ranked right up there with the with those who have been doing the show for a bit. Loved his tap with Sam Poon in Expressing Yourself. I began to notice a few nuances that appeared different from the usual...there was no jumping off the piano at the end of Born to Boogie, and some slight hesitancy when dancing with older Billy. However he, apparently injured, did a fantastic, fantabulous job with Angry Dance!

As we moved into the Christmas gathering, after the intermission, I noticed Billy looked taller and suddenly realized it was Noah Parets who had taken over. Noah was, as always, great fun to watch and enjoy.

An announcement following the show stated that Mitchell had perservered through part I and would be "looked after" (my words) and he, in fact, came out to a standing ovation. Phew! "Nerve wracking, you know"!

I had a wondrous time and will be traveling to Baltimore for 4 more Billy's before the troop moves on!
